Wellness Reminder
At Center Pointe, we want to care for our community in all respects. To that end, we are asking that members & attenders take precautions to keep themselves and others safe. Please stay home and join our Live Stream…
- If you or a member of your immediate family is covid positive.
- If you or anyone in your immediate family has had a fever in the last 2 weeks.
- If you or anyone in your close circle is waiting on a COVID test result.
- If you are under the weather.
- If you can’t wear a mask.

What about Masks?
- In accordance with state-wide mandates, we are requiring masks to be worn inside our facilities at all times, AND outside when social distancing cannot be achieved (ex: in line).
- Masks will be required while singing for those not on stage. The worship team will not be wearing masks on stage. Appropriate measures will be taken to keep them as safe as possible.
- If you have a pre-existing condition that precludes you from wearing a mask, we are asking that you stay at home and join us for online worship at this time.

What about Cleaning Procedures?
- We are planning for increased cleaning inside every empty room in-between service times (this includes the Worship Center). Please forward any more specific questions about cleaning and cleaning products to info@cpcc.church.
- Hand sanitizer will be readily available throughout our facility.
What if there is a Positive Diagnosis?
- If we are made aware of a positive case in our building, we are prepared to contact everyone who might have been exposed, to take the appropriate precautionary measures, and to respond with even more rigorous cleaning efforts in the areas of exposure.
- A Level 4 / Purple public emergency alert in Ohio will mean that we shut down our in-person services and return to our online-only approach.
